Director of Partnerships (Product)

Electric is a Series B startup backed by Bessemer Venture Partners, GGV Capital, Primary Venture Partners, 01 Advisors and led by a team of seasoned entrepreneurs, operators, and technologists. With software forming the foundation of every office, Electric is the world’s first all-in-one, modern IT support solution that can truly meet the needs of growing businesses. Through a chat interface, personalized service, and flat-rate pricing we keep our client’s email, computers, Wi-Fi and software running smoothly at a fraction of the cost and headaches normally experienced with traditional managed service providers.

Overview

We’re looking for a dynamic, self-motivated Director of Partnerships who will be responsible for product led growth and expansion of Electric by developing broad and deep alliances with key technology and SaaS partners. Our vision is to establish partnerships with top business software companies to better recommend and deploy best-in-class configurations for our customers. 

The Role

The Director of Partnerships will collaborate with the executive team to build and maintain a pipeline of relationships with potential partners, taking responsibility for the relationship throughout all stages. This role takes primary responsibility for the execution and integration of new partnerships, partnering with key business partners across the organization, including product, engineering, marketing, finance, and any CS teams impacted. They will track, report, and optimize the performance of partnerships, including identifying issues as they arise, assessing possible solutions, and executing those solutions.
